GOD IS GOOD!



Even today, after all is said, done and read, the majority of people who live both IN and OUT of Christianity, still believe they have to be good to get into Heaven. Even worse, they believe that THEY are good enough to get there on their own!


Scripture records the incident of the "rich young ruler" in Luke 18:18-19 who went up to Jesus and called Him "good teacher". Jesus' response was ""Why do you call me good?" Jesus answered. "No one is good - except God alone."


The reason GOD IS GOOD is included here as a Name to be prayed is this - we cannot separate the Attribute of from the Person. We also have to look very closely as the word Jesus used for "good" here - Agathos in the Original Greek. Remember Jesus is describing His Father - God, and our Father, Whom NO man has seen and lived!


Jesus is saying here that Father is "Agathos" and it means He is GOOD, whether His Goodness is visible or not. The rain falls equally on the saved and the unsaved. The unsaved co-worker down the hall could actually be in better health and more legitimately wealthy than you, a hardworking Christian who is just getting by. God is Good to whomever He wishes and He gives Grace to all, hoping and looking for ALL to come to Him.

The invitation is open to everyone, from any part of this great planet Earth. Nothing is stopping anyone from coming to a saving knowledge of the Truth, but human pride. Regardless, God is still Good. His Name is Good. His Son is God. His Spirit is Good.



Today's scripture to meditate and pray over is Psalm 119:65-72:

You have dealt well with your servant,
O LORD, according to your word.
Teach me good judgment and knowledge,
for I believe in your commandments.
Before I was afflicted I went astray,
but now I keep your word.
You are good and do good;
teach me your statutes.
The insolent smear me with lies,
but with my whole heart I keep your precepts;
their heart is unfeeling like fat,
but I delight in your law.
It is good for me that I was afflicted,
that I might learn your statutes.
The law of your mouth is better to me
than thousands of gold and silver pieces.
(Psalm 119:65-72 ESV)
